Penrith coach Ivan Cleary believes his side's slow starts could inject a bit of confidence ahead of tonight's NRL grand final in Sydney
25 October 2020 - article from www.rugbyleague.co.nz
The Panthers are in their first decider in 17 years, up against the Melbourne Storm who are looking for their third premiership win since 2012.
In both of their finals victories, Penrith have come form behind after conceding first.
Cleary says it shows they can pick themselves up when they're down.
Kick off's at 9:30pm.
